The cap for CEC applications May 2014 till Dec. 2014 is 8000, with additional sub-caps of 200 for few Type B NOCs.
However, once the cap of 8000 is reached, CIC will not accept any more applications, even if the sub-caps are not filled.
Till 22 Sept 2014, applications received at CIC = 3342. (This data is updated weekly.)
CIC will continue receiving applications until end of Dec. 2014, as long as the cap of 8000 is not reached.
